Re: Think Broadband results

Quote:
Originally Posted by bolgerp View Post
Hi all

I have just created a Think Broadband profile and have no idea how to interpret the results (even having read their website)... I THINK the below is a fairly standard graph with a Superhub 3 and VM but would appreciate any advice/insights...
Your graph looks good!

There's not much to say about it. The green bit should always stay pretty consistent and low at all times. The odd blip isn't uncommon but if you see lots of them, there's a big issue.

The blue part is similar - while the green should be pretty flat, you'll see a tiny bit of variance on the blue. This is your "jitter" and measures how inconsistent your connection is, but for the likes of downloading and streaming makes no difference, it's more a problem for online gaming. Yours looks great!

The yellow will see more spikes than anything else and yours is largely fine. If you see a lot of yellow, you'll see your blue getting worse as well.

Red is bad. Any red is bad.
